Microsoft’s 2027 Vision: Redefining AI Capabilities
According to the report, Mustafa Suleyman, who recently joined Microsoft to head its consumer AI efforts and previously co-founded DeepMind and Inflection AI, has set an aggressive target for the company. His vision is to produce AI models by 2027 that are significantly more advanced than anything currently available, potentially heralding a new era of artificial general intelligence (AGI). The term “state-of-the-art” in this context refers to AI models possessing capabilities far beyond current large language models (LLMs)—models that can not only understand and generate human-like text but also exhibit advanced reasoning, multimodal comprehension (understanding images, audio, video alongside text), and potentially even autonomous goal-seeking abilities.
This push is part of Microsoft’s broader strategy to cement its leadership in AI, building on its substantial investments in OpenAI and its own internal research and development. The tech giant is reportedly mobilizing vast compute resources, talent, and strategic partnerships to meet this demanding goal. Such advancements could fundamentally alter how industries operate, how individuals interact with technology, and how complex problems are solved globally. India at the Forefront: Opportunities and Preparedness
India, with its vast talent pool, burgeoning startup ecosystem, and growing digital economy, stands to be a significant beneficiary and contributor to this global AI evolution. The availability of advanced AI models by 2027 could catalyze innovation across various Indian sectors. In healthcare, these models could revolutionize diagnostics, drug discovery, and personalized treatment plans, making quality healthcare more accessible even in remote areas. For agriculture, AI could offer unprecedented precision in crop management, pest detection, and yield prediction, directly benefiting millions of farmers. The education sector could see personalized learning experiences, intelligent tutoring systems, and content generation tailored to India’s diverse linguistic landscape.
However, leveraging these future models effectively will require significant preparedness. India will need to continue investing heavily in digital infrastructure, including high-speed internet and robust data centres. Furthermore, skilling and reskilling the workforce to design, deploy, and manage these advanced AI systems will be paramount. The ethical implications, including data privacy, algorithmic bias, and job displacement, will also demand careful consideration and proactive policy-making.
